Transaction 295629dcecd793c4befa8e8351046b15e6a05561f95281eaa2b4b94c5d6357bc

1 Input
2 Outputs
  • 295629dcecd793c4befa8e8351046b15e6a05561f95281eaa2b4b94c5d6357bc:0
  • value  2410000
    address  32VsZRZpVgj7SEGnj46LKtoiQXiH6rmXV6
  • 295629dcecd793c4befa8e8351046b15e6a05561f95281eaa2b4b94c5d6357bc:1
  • value  588023154
    address  1B5E5LJtsfx14dkqKMMu4hF9GV5yetFEpD